Alternate Leg ID: Leg 6 Area of Operations: Transatlantic westward crossing, North Atlantic Dates: November 24, 1971 to December 10, 1971 Chief scientist: Martin F. Kane Objectives: (a) To investigate the acoustic reflection characteristics of the mid-Atlantic ridge and other oceanic structures such as the Vema fracture zone and the Sierra Leone rise; (b) to correlate data from JOIDES drill holes with subbottom acoustic reflection profiles in oceanic areas; and (c) to extend our knowledge of sediment distribution and thickness in the deep ocean. Type of Activity: Subbottom acoustic reflection Information to be derived: Suspended Sediment Concentrations Bathymetric Maps Magnetic intensity and gravity Subbottom acoustic reflection profiles Summary: The major result so far is that various geophysical data have been successfully recorded over a number of features. Gravity and magnetics records will require computer processing to be usable. USGS Project Number:
